Leadership Review Briefing — Hiring Freeze, Meridia Systems Division
Effective this quarter, all external hiring in Meridia Systems is paused. Open requisitions (14) cancelled; two offers in flight honored. Expected savings: roughly 6% of divisional payroll through year-end. Contractor spend capped at current run rate. Internal transfers permitted with VP sign-off. Attrition backfills require CFO approval. Finance to track variance monthly and report at each leadership review. Rationale for the freeze is set out in the restricted note below.

board note of tadup-tajog: Headcount on the Oliiel team goes from 31 to 88 by the end of February. Gross margin on Oliiel came in at 62 percent against a plan of 29 percent.

Finance Review Summary — Tarnell Systems

For sales leads. The support outsourcing plan with Quillon Services clears the cost threshold: projected savings of 22% annually after transition costs. Headcount in the Merridale centre reduces over two quarters. Customer satisfaction risk rated moderate; SLA penalties negotiated. Sales teams should expect revised escalation paths from August. Finance endorses proceeding, subject to the confidential planning note appended below.

board note of fahog-bawep: The renewal with Holixax Holdings closes at $20 million a year, 20 percent below the last contract. Project Druwyn slips by two quarters because of the supplier delay.

# Build Provenance: Image Cache Leak Fix

Context for new contractors: the Murrow thumbnail cache leaked ~40MB/hr because evicted entries kept decoder handles alive. Fixed in the cache module by closing handles on eviction. Verify with the soak test before approving. The patched build is identified directly below.

build token for kagaf-hahof: htk14_9d3d4d26d7d8de